The Potential Challenges
Despite the numerous advantages, there are several challenges that Amazon might face if it decides to accept cryptocurrency in 2018.
1. Regulatory Uncertainty: The regulatory landscape for cryptocurrency is still evolving. Different countries have different laws and regulations regarding the use of digital currencies. Amazon would need to navigate through these complexities and ensure compliance with the laws in various jurisdictions.
2. Customer Base: While the interest in cryptocurrency is growing, it is still a niche market. Amazon would need to consider the potential impact on its customer base, especially those who are not familiar with digital currencies.
3. Scalability: Cryptocurrency transactions can be slow and expensive, especially during peak times. Amazon would need to ensure that its system can handle the increased load without compromising on the user experience.
4. Technical Integration: Integrating cryptocurrency into Amazon's existing payment infrastructure would require significant technical expertise and resources.
